Kagraner Sommer
This French butterhead was originally from Germany and is a 'sleeper.' Unlike most butterheads, it is very slow to bolt in summer heat. Excellent for window boxes and indoor pots, this lettuce also makes a cute border plant. The mild tasting leaves are soft and buttery, not crunchy. Medium-sized heads. This packet plants three 10-foot rows or seven successive plantings of 5-foot rows.
Days to Maturity: 58
When to Sow Outside: Early Spring, 3 to 4 weeks before last frost,
and successive plantings every 3 weeks.
When to Sow Inside: Six weeks before last frost and in summer when
outside temperatures are too warm for the seeds to germinate
Seed Depth: 1/8"
Seed Spacing: 1"
Row Spacing: 8"
Days to Emerge: 5 - 10
Thinning: When 1/2" tall thin to 5" apart
